Fa-Waffle with Harissa Sauce
Our fun take on falafel: A deep fried ball of ground chickpea’s.
Or I should really say Timothy’s (chef) take on it!
Fa-Waffle:
1 tbsp extra virgin olive oil
1 finely chopped onion
1 garlic clove minced
15oz chickpeas drained
1 cup of loosely packed cilantro
1 cup of loosely packed parsley
1 cup quinoa cooked
1 tsp curry powder
1/4 tsp cayenne pepper
1 tbsp lemon juice
3/4 cup bread crumbs (we used gluten and yeast free bread) toast and grind
Add all ingredients in vita-mix maker and then mold into round balls that your will place into a greased waffle maker.
Harissa:
5 dried red chili peppers
3 garlic cloves miced
1/2 tsp salt
2 tbsp olive oil
1 tsp ground coriander
1 tsp ground caraway
1/2 tsp cumin
Grind all ingredients into a sauce for on top the fa-waffle’s!

Doily Garland
What to do with grandma’s collection of doily’s?
Recycle them into a whimsical birthday garland or it’s also perfect for a little girls nursery!
You just need twine and as many doily’s as you want.
As seen above its strung from the back of holes first and then following through the front (enough spaces that the doily is tight).
Make sure each time you string a doily it’s the same way. ;) I had to redo one.
Spicy Spoons
Spice up your kitchen or next dinner party with these brightly painted spoons!
What you will need:
-Tape
-Spoons
-Paint of your choice
I bought the package of spoons for one dollar at our local dollar store and then taped off where I wanted the paint to end and then just finger painted on each color!
Let dry for 10 minutes and then take off tape.
Now you have a fun spoon for each dish!
Tip: If you plan on using them multiple times I would put a clear lacquer on them so paint does not wash or chip off
